SCOPE OF POSITION:
Under the supervision of the JMFL Program Manager, the Jarvie Memorial Family Lodge (JMFL) PT Program Aide is responsible for supporting the safe and effective daily operation of the shelter. Responsibilities include monitoring resident and facility safety; conducting property walkthroughs; preparing and serving meals; monitoring supply inventory; performing facility cleaning, room changeovers and minor maintenance tasks; completing reports, documentation, and shift changeovers; responding appropriately to emergencies; and providing respectful support to residents while ensuring compliance with program policies and procedures.
This position is On-Call, and employees will be given as much notice as possible when a shift is available, based on program needs.
